LMDA pushes for representation in congress

By Robert E. Roperos

Butuan City (10 November) — Board of Trustees (BOT) of the Lake Mainit Development Alliance (LMDA) pushes for the association’s representation in the House of Representatives during its meeting on Tuesday (November 10) at the Agusan del Norte Provincial Training Center, Capitol Site, this city. LMDA publishes its latest official newsletter

The Lake Mainit Development Alliance publishes its official publication “The Lake Mainit Chronicle” issue No. 07 for the period January-June 2010. The new issue covers 10 pages in 5.50 MB pdf file size. The Lake Mainit Chronicle is published with funding support from Philippines-Australia Community Assistance Program and Foundation for the Philippine Environment though Green Mindanao Association, Inc. Newly Elected Officials in Lake Mainit Cluster on First Automated National and Local Elections

The Province of Surigao del Norte and Agusan del Norte with the eight municipalities in Lake Mainit cluster namely Sison, Mainit, Tubod and Alegria in Surigao del Norte and municipalities of Kitcharao, Jabonga, Santiago and Tubay have elected new public officials on its first nationwide automated national and local elections on May 10, 2010. Lake Mainit LGUs completed Advance Microsoft Access 2007 Training Course

Five municipalities in Lake Mainit and LMDA staff successfully completed the 4-day training course on Advance Microsoft Access 2007 Operations for Databank Designing and Management on June 22-25, 2010 held at Municipal Development Center, Alegria, Surigao del Norte. The training is the continuation of the 5 days basic training course on Microsoft Access 2007 which was held last June 3-4 and June 16-18, 2010. (continue).

Lake Mainit Environment Governance shared by LMDA Director

The The Lake Mainit Development Alliance (LMDA) Program Director, Engr. Kaiser B. Recabo, Jr. is one of the invited presenters during the 3-day Forum on PACAP and the Environment with a theme: “Building Community Resilience, Sustaining Development” held at Dotties Place Hotel on April 15 – 17, 2010. Engr. Recabo speaks about LMDA experience on environment governance and lake protection as an institution responsible in resources conservation and development for the lake ecosystem. He made mention of the crafting of the Lake Mainit Unified Fishery Ordinance as one of the keys to proper and systematic management of this God given bounty. (continue)

LMDA ATENDED THE FIRST STAKEHOLDERS’ WORKSHOP FOR PARTNERSHIP FOR BIODIVERSITY CONSERVATION: Mainstreaming in Local Agricultural Landscape (BPP)

The Global Environmental Facility (GEF) has approved the project preparation grant for the development of the Project Document and CEO Endorsement for the project entitled “Partnership for Biodiversity Conservation: Mainstreaming in local agricultural landscapes (BPP). The executing partners are the DENR, DA, DILG, Fauna and Flora International (FFI), Haribon Foundation, Philconserve, Conservation International-Philippines and Foundation for the Philippine Evironment. LMDA Board of Trustees Meet in its 13th Regular Meeting in Surigao 


LMDA conducts its 13th BOT meeting on February 9, 2010 at Tavern Hotel, Surigao City. The meeting was attended by Hon. Erlpe John M. Amante, Provincial Governor of Agusan del Norte at the same time the Chairperson of Lake Mainit Development Alliance (LMDA); Hon. Robert Ace S. Barbers, Governor of Surigao del Norte. It was also attended by Municipal Mayors, namely; Hon. Aristotle E. Montante of Municipality of Kitcharao; Hon. Glicerio M. Monton, Jr., of municipality of Jabonga; Hon. Franklin D. Lim of Santiago; Hon. Dominador G. Esma, Jr. of Alegria and Hon. Leicester P. Fetalvero of Municipality of Sison. (continue)
